#9d1718 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d1718 is composed of 61.6% red, 9%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.4%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 359.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 35.3%. #9d1718 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2e30 with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#9d1718 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9d1718 has RGB values of R:157, G:23,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.85,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10295064.

Shades and Tints of #9d1718
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030000 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9d1718
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5555 is the less saturated color, while #b20204 is the most saturated one.
